ICCIMA hosts gathering of economic enterprises

September 8, 2024 - 14:8

TEHRAN – Iran Chamber of Commerce, Industries, Mines and Agriculture (ICCIMA) held the 14th conference of the country’s economic enterprises dubbed “Economic enterprises, leaders of development” on Saturday to explore challenges and opportunities facing the mentioned entities.

Chaired by the ICCIMA Head Samad Hassanzadeh, the conference was attended by representatives of several economic enterprises from various provinces.

As the ICCIMA portal reported, the event has received more attention due to the government's approach in using the private sector’s capacities, and a part of it is dedicated to the introduction of the country’s top enterprises.

Speaking at the conference, Hassanzadeh emphasized that the private sector is seeking to clarify the position of enterprises in the country’s economy, adding: “Economic enterprises guide and direct the individual efforts of businesses and are a bridge for communication between people and the government.”

Underlining the role of enterprises in expressing concerns and economic problems and finding operational solutions to face them, Hassanzadeh said: "In recent years, we have seen that after the implementation of any policy, challenges emerge, the cause of which is the lack of consensus with enterprises; While the principle of consulting organizations and economic enterprises is emphasized in the law.”

Pointing out that the multiplicity of organizations granting licenses for establishing enterprises and the existence of parallel economic entities are among the problems in this field, he said: “Using the capacity of economic enterprises is one example of specialization that leads to productivity growth. Based on this, we hope that the 14th government will take advantage of their capacity in the policy-making process so that the private sector can fulfill its great mission in the path of economic development.”
